* test(unit-fast): isolate computer-tool.test-helpers consumers
The unit-fast shard classifier recognizes "stateful" test helpers
(those whose source trips a disqualifying pattern such as `vi.mock(`
or top-level dynamic `import`) via `statefulTestHelperImportPattern`,
so that tests importing them are routed to the isolated pool instead
of the shared `isolate:false` pool.
`computer-tool.test-helpers` was missing from that pattern, even though
the helper sets up `vi.mock("./gateway.js")`, `vi.mock("./nodes-utils.js")`
and uses top-level `await import(...)` — i.e. it is stateful. Its
consumers (`computer-tool.v2/schema/context.test.ts`) therefore
classified with empty `reasons`, fell into the `isolate:false` pool,
and relied on `vi.mock` against a shared module registry. When another
test file loaded the real `./gateway.js` / `./nodes-utils.js` in the
same worker first, the mock was bypassed and `computer-tool.v2.test.ts`
threw `GatewayCredentialsRequiredError: gateway node.list requires
credentials` for all 8 of its cases — while passing in isolation.
Add `computer-tool\.test-helpers` to the pattern (mirroring the existing
`message-action-runner\.test-helpers` entry) so consumers are routed to
the isolated pool where the mock is honored.
Verified on `main` (`83d279a`), Node 24.15.0:
- Before: `pnpm test:unit:fast` -> 8 failures in
`src/agents/tools/computer-tool.v2.test.ts` (`GatewayCredentialsRequiredError`);
the file passes alone (8/8).
- After: the three consumers classify `inIsolated=true`; `pnpm test:unit:fast`
no longer runs them in the shared pool; the suite's only remaining
failures are unrelated (`test/ui.presenter-next-run.test.ts` locale,
`test/scripts/resolve-openclaw-ref.test.ts` git version) and the
computer-tool suite passes (16/16) under `vitest --isolate`.

narrowIncludePatterns returned the caller's CLI pattern whenever it overlapped
a lane's include list, instead of intersecting the two. A directory argument
therefore replaced the lane's curated scope with a broad glob:
pnpm test src/plugins
-> unit-fast include became ["src/plugins/**/*.test.*"] instead of its
60 curated files
-> contracts-plugin include became ["src/plugins/**/*.test.*"] instead of
["src/plugins/contracts/**/*.test.ts"]
Both lanes run isolate: false, so every re-admitted file shared a worker with
unrelated files. unit-fast re-admitted exactly the files it excludes for being
stateful (module mocking, dynamic import, filesystem state), and contracts-plugin
pulled in every sibling test outside contracts/. That produced nondeterministic
cross-file pollution: failures that moved between files and lanes run to run,
reproduced in neither isolation nor CI.
Keep the lane's own pattern when it is rooted deeper than the CLI selection,
otherwise keep the CLI pattern. Equal-depth selections are unchanged, so the
existing scoped-config expectations still hold.
Coverage is unchanged; only duplicate execution is removed. `pnpm test src/plugins`
went from 1171 file-executions (3.4x duplication over 346 files) to 344 — the two
remaining files are .e2e.test.ts, excluded by the shared config by design.
* fix(macos): make the whole AI candidate row clickable and clear stale exhausted verdicts
Live-testing pick-during-testing on 2026-08-11 showed clicks on a candidate
row's blank stretch (between the title/subtitle texts or over the spacer)
silently doing nothing: plain-style buttons only hit-test opaque label
pixels. A user trying to pick Claude Code while Codex auto-tests can click
the visually highlighted row and get no outcome. .contentShape(Rectangle())
makes the full row hit-test.
Also, after auto-candidates exhaust, a user-picked retest left the stale
"None of the found options worked" card up while the new test visibly ran;
userSelect now clears exhaustedAutoCandidates when a fresh attempt begins.

* feat(sessions): keep archived transcripts by default with zstd cold storage
Codex-style retention: deleting or resetting a session archives its
transcript as a zstd-compressed JSONL artifact (plain when the runtime
lacks node:zlib zstd) and keeps it until the disk budget evicts oldest
first. resetArchiveRetention now governs both deleted and reset archives
and defaults to keep; maxDiskBytes defaults to 2gb so retention stays
bounded, with archives evicted before live sessions. The cron reaper
follows the same knob instead of deleting archives on its own timer.
* fix(state): converge agent DB migration lineages and bound database growth
Merge coherence: run both structure-gated legacy memory-schema repairs
(flip-lineage drop, main-lineage identity rebuild) before the flip
migration so pre-flip v1/v2 and pre-merge flip v1/v4 databases all
converge, and hoist foreign_keys=OFF outside the schema transaction
where the pragma was silently ignored and the v1 sessions rebuild
cascade-deleted session_entries.
Growth guards: fresh agent DBs enable auto_vacuum=INCREMENTAL, WAL
maintenance releases freed pages in bounded passes (never a blocking
full VACUUM), and doctor reports state/agent DB bloat from freelist
stats.

* fix(test): make unit tests hermetic against host config and build state
Two host-state leaks made the full suite fail deterministically on developer
and agent machines while CI stayed green:
- Built checkouts: bundled-plugin manifest discovery prefers dist/extensions,
which by design excludes externalized official plugins (e.g. qwen). Tests
that depend on manifest-driven endpoint classification (DashScope cases in
media-understanding and model-compat) failed in any checkout after
pnpm build. test-env now pins OPENCLAW_BUNDLED_PLUGINS_DIR to the source
extensions tree (with the vitest trust opt-in) so discovery matches CI
regardless of local build state; discovery tests keep managing the env
per case.
- unit-fast shards: setupFiles was empty, so auto-curated tests that read
config saw the developer's real ~/.openclaw/openclaw.json; any key the
branch schema rejects failed those tests. unit-fast and
unit-fast-fake-timers now load a minimal env-isolation setup
(test/setup.env.ts) that installs the isolated test home without the
shared setup's module mocks.
